- Kirby ThomasMay 10, 2021 · 4 years agoSure! Robinhood's interest feature allows users to earn interest on their digital currency holdings. It works by lending out users' digital currencies to institutional borrowers, such as exchanges and market makers, who need them for various purposes. In return, users receive a portion of the interest generated from these loans. The interest rate is determined by market demand and can vary over time. To be eligible for the interest feature, users need to meet certain requirements set by Robinhood, such as maintaining a minimum balance of digital currencies in their account. Overall, it's a way for users to earn passive income on their digital currency holdings without the need for active trading.
